Entrepreneur development training for mothers of girl children in Salem

Salem  09 Feb, 2021

HIV/AIDS has a profound impact on the lives of infected/affected families. The epidemic has compounded a whole range of challenges surrounding poverty and inequalities, which adversely affect the education of children, especially girls. The recent COVID-19 pandemic has further deteriorated their livelihoods. To help these families overcome the challenges of livelihood and ensure continuous education for their children, the AEA’s ENLIGHT project conducted an ‘Entrepreneur development training program’ for mothers of girl children in Salem. The training program focused on various aspects of entrepreneur development, which ranged from developing and executing a business idea to a business plan.
